A three-cycle power generation system integrating fuel cells and supercritical carbon dioxide electrolysis
By integrating fuel cells and supercritical carbon dioxide water electrolysis three-cycle power generation system, the problems of direct CO2 emissions and high energy loss in coal-fired power plants are solved, the clean separation and efficient utilization of CO2 are achieved, and the power generation efficiency is improved.

[0001] The present invention relates to the technical field of coal-based power generation, in particular to a water electrolysis three-cycle power generation system integrating a fuel cell and supercritical carbon dioxide. Background Art
[0002] Coal-fired power generation dominates my country's energy mix. However, coal-fired power plants currently emit nearly 1 kg of CO2 and other pollutants for every kilowatt-hour of electricity generated. With the rapid development of the global economy and the increasingly severe environmental and climate pressures, developing clean and efficient power generation technologies has become a consensus among countries.
[0003] First, when existing coal-fired power plants generate electricity, the CO2 they produce is directly emitted into the air, which has an impact on the environment. In addition, a large amount of heat is required to decarbonize the CO2, which increases the overall energy loss.
[0004] Secondly, existing coal-fired power plants suffer from large power losses during power generation, which affects the power generation efficiency of the coal-fired power plants.

[0025] Compared with the prior art, the present invention has the following beneficial effects:
[0026] The present invention generates synthesis gas by introducing coal and supercritical water into a gasification chamber. After the synthesis gas passes through a high-temperature heat exchanger, it enters a waste heat boiler together with H2 generated by a water electrolysis device, O2 that has not completely reacted at the cathode of a solid oxide fuel cell, and O2 from an air preheater for mixed combustion. The heat generated by the combustion in the waste heat boiler heats water to generate supercritical water, which is supplied to the gasification chamber. The flue gas generated by the combustion in the waste heat boiler passes through a waste heat recovery device to preheat the water, and then in a condenser, the flue gas is cooled and separated to form water, gaseous CO2, and clean flue gas. Part of the water separated in the condenser enters the water electrolysis device, and the other part enters the waste heat recovery device to absorb the flue gas from the waste heat boiler. The waste heat enters the waste heat boiler; the clean flue gas formed by separation in the condenser and free of impurities such as CO2, ash, sulfur, and heavy metals is discharged into the atmosphere; the gaseous CO2 formed by separation in the condenser is compressed in two stages by compressor three and compressor two, and cooled in two stages by low-temperature heat exchanger two and low-temperature heat exchanger one, and the gaseous CO2 becomes liquid CO2, which is convenient for storage and transportation. Compared with the existing ones, the present invention realizes the efficient and clean utilization of coal, and the CO2 in the exhaust gas can be separated from the CO2 through the condensation process. There is no need to provide a large amount of heat for the decarbonization process, which reduces the overall energy loss, and avoids the emission of harmful impurities in the CO2 into the air, thereby avoiding impact on the environment.
[0027] The present invention uses a wind turbine and solar cells to power a water electrolysis device. The water electrolysis device receives a portion of the water from the condenser and decomposes the water into H2 and O2. The H2 enters the waste heat boiler, and the O2 enters the cathode of the solid oxide fuel cell. In the solid oxide fuel cell, oxygen is catalytically reduced at the cathode and reacts with the synthesis gas on the anode side through the electrolyte, directly converting the chemical energy of the synthesis gas into electrical energy and generating water and CO2.
[0028] Secondly, the turbine is coaxially arranged with the generator body. The CO2 at the outlet of compressor 1 absorbs the cooling heat generated by the compression process of the gaseous CO2 through low-temperature heat exchangers 1 and 2, absorbs part of the heat of the synthesis gas through the high-temperature heat exchanger, and reaches supercriticality, expands and performs work in the turbine. The turbine rotates and drives the generator body to output electrical energy to the outside. Compared with the existing ones, the present invention adopts clean energy to perform power generation and can generate sufficient electricity for its own use during the power generation process, thereby reducing power loss during the power generation process and improving the power generation efficiency of the coal-fired power plant. [0039] Based on Example 1 and Example 2, CO2 has a critical temperature of 32°C and a critical pressure of 7.38 MPa. It can be cooled to its critical temperature by water or air at ambient temperature. The supercritical carbon dioxide circulation power generation system uses carbon dioxide as a circulating working fluid, converts thermal energy into mechanical energy, drives turbine 11 to drive the generator to generate electricity, and has the characteristics of cleanliness, high efficiency, and small system size. It is a new power generation technology with great development prospects. The supercritical CO2 circulation power generation system has a wide range of heat source temperatures. The system integrates supercritical CO2 circulation technology and can achieve cascade utilization of energy by absorbing the heat of synthesis gas and recovering the heat of CO2 multi-stage compression cooling, generating additional power output.
[0040] A fuel cell is a chemical power generation device that converts the chemical energy of a fuel directly into electrical energy. Solid oxide fuel cells (SOFCs), a type of high-temperature fuel cell, are named because their electrolytes are mostly solid oxides. Their structure primarily consists of a cathode, an anode, and an electrolyte. When oxygen and a gaseous fuel are introduced into the cathode and anode, respectively, the oxygen is catalytically reduced at the cathode to form oxygen ions, which then migrate through the electrolyte to the anode. There, they react with the gaseous fuel to produce water, CO2, and electrons. These electrons are then transported through an external circuit to the cathode, participating in the oxygen reduction reaction, thus forming a closed circuit and generating current.

[0043] The turbine 11 is coaxially arranged with the generator body 10. The CO2 at the outlet of the compressor 14 absorbs the cooling heat generated during the compression of the gaseous CO2 through the low-temperature heat exchanger 16 and the low-temperature heat exchanger 2 18, absorbs part of the heat of the synthesis gas through the high-temperature heat exchanger 2, and reaches supercriticality. It expands and performs work in the turbine 11. The turbine 11 rotates and drives the generator body 10 to output electrical energy. The CO2 at the outlet of the turbine 11 passes through the air preheater and transfers heat to the O2, which increases the temperature of the O2 and reduces the temperature of the CO2, facilitating the compression of the CO2 in the compressor 14. The CO2 at the outlet of the compressor 14 then enters the low-temperature heat exchanger 16 and the low-temperature heat exchanger 2 18, and this cycle repeats. The present invention uses clean energy to generate electricity and can generate sufficient electricity for its own use during the power generation process, thereby reducing power loss during the power generation process and improving the power generation efficiency of the coal-fired power plant.
[0044] Finally, the air separator 13 decomposes the air into N2 and O2. The O2 is heated by the heat exchanger body 12 and enters the waste heat boiler 4 to serve as an oxidant in the combustion process. The water electrolysis device 9 produces H2 and O2. The synthesis gas and O2 are respectively introduced into the anode and cathode of the solid oxide fuel cell 3, and react in the solid oxide fuel cell 3 to generate electricity. The gas that has not completely reacted in the solid oxide fuel cell 3 is introduced into the waste heat boiler 4 for combustion. The H2 produced by the water electrolysis device 9 and the O2 produced by the air separator 13 enter the waste heat boiler 4 as supplementary fuel and oxidant.
